Output 61d9fb37c1b308f42d63ac7e050ac22b61d91cf5b520ac5291ec9968da22caeb:173

value
32768
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e0bba639ab267962f28a0d4cbb8c91a3ad36a4ff3db17ccf874a66a63b36b9d7
address
bc1puza6vwdtyeuk9u52p4xthry35wkndf8l8kchenu8ffn2vwekh8tsdc43uz
transaction
61d9fb37c1b308f42d63ac7e050ac22b61d91cf5b520ac5291ec9968da22caeb
confirmations
29986
spent
true